WebWatch on. No, a deionizer and a water softener are not the same. A water softener is used to reduce the levels of calcium and magnesium, which can lead to hard water and cause plumbing issues, in water. A water softener usually works by replacing them with sodium. The water softener regeneration process is how water softener eliminates positive ions stuck on the resin beads and then recharges them to hold a negative charge once more through ion exchange. This task ensures that it can continue reusing the beads to remove hardness minerals from water.
